Halloween on your iPod: Carnival of Souls
Time for another freaky (and free!) horror film for your holiday enjoyment. This time it’s the cult classic Carnival of Souls. Filmed by a director of educational shorts, the film makes excellent use of low-budget special effects and camera work to create jarring, haunting images that will give you both… Continue Reading »
